Shaping Tone in Subtractive Synthesis

Now that we have a basic understanding of how to generate tone, let's explore how to shape that tone.

Understanding Waveforms

The waveforms we've discussed are our raw material. We wouldn't want every sound we produce to simply sound like:

  • A square wave
  • A sawtooth wave

The Role of Filters

To change these sounds, we use a filter. The purpose of a filter in subtractive synthesis is to remove portions of the signal, specifically, portions of the frequency spectrum, that are being sent from the oscillators.

After filtering:

  • A rich-sounding sawtooth wave can become a smooth, warm sound by eliminating the high-end information through filtering.

Filter Controls

The filter section of most subtractive synthesizers will contain two primary controls:

  1. Cutoff Frequency (often abbreviated to 'cutoff')

    • Cutoff refers to where the filter is cutting off:
      • Higher frequencies (if you're using a high cut filter)
      • Lower frequencies (if you're using a low cut filter)
  2. Resonance

    • Resonance allows you to take a set of frequencies and boost them, resulting in a much more resonant sound.
